How Headlight Neglect Impacts insurance coverage

Manny drivers are unaware that the overall condition of their vehicle, including the proper function of all mandatory components like headlights, directly influences their insurance coverage. Failure to maintain these components can not only void your right to compensation after an accident but also trigger a “clawback” clause, allowing the insurance company to reclaim previously paid damages.

One seemingly trivial issue—the efficiency of your headlights—can become a decisive factor in determining liability after an accident. Dim, cloudy, or non-functioning headlights can considerably compromise visibility, making you responsible for incidents that might otherwise have been avoidable.

The High Cost of Negligence: When Maintenance Turns Into a Financial Burden

If an accident is attributed to poor headlight maintenance, such as dull, opaque, or non-functioning lights, your insurance company may exercise its right of recourse.This means that even after compensating the injured party, the insurer can demand full reimbursement from you for the amounts paid. this mechanism is typically outlined in the policy’s general terms and conditions, applicable when the insured violates legal or contractual obligations.

Consider this: if a driver causes an accident and it’s proven that compromised visibility due to inadequate headlights was a contributing factor, the financial burden could easily surpass €10,000. This significant expense can affect even those who believed they were fully protected with an active car insurance policy. [2]

Proactive Maintenance: Protecting yourself and Your Wallet

To avoid these potential financial pitfalls, prioritize regular headlight maintenance. Ensure your headlights are clean,clear,and functioning correctly.Replace bulbs as needed and address any cloudiness or discoloration promptly. Regular checks and proactive maintenance can save you from unexpected expenses and ensure your safety on the road. [1]
